Output d53aaf616ef55465b9a705b451d055109eb8978632e5dbb0cf6fdd1cfe9d1b60:1

value
102100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 876d35547f99d8cdc4c5fd75224215b185da4c2d OP_EQUAL
address
3E35yNJCzfXHNadwhaPTDL441GdTxVAera
transaction
d53aaf616ef55465b9a705b451d055109eb8978632e5dbb0cf6fdd1cfe9d1b60
spent
true